Ukraine: US plans to join record of damage caused by Russia

The United States of America (US) announced this Monday its intention to integrate, as a founding associate member, the registry of damages caused by the Russian aggression against Ukraine, an initiative of the Council of Europe.

As Head of the US Delegation to the Summit of Heads of State and Government of the Council of Europe, Ambassador Linda Thomas-Greenfield, U.S. Representative to the United Nations (UN), will represent the United States in accession to the comprehensive partial agreement that the register”the US mission to the UN said in a statement.

Registration is one of the most important decisions that will result from the summit of the Council of Europe, the organization from which the Russian Federation was suspended on February 25, 2022 and excluded on March 16 of the same year.

“As President Joe Biden has stated, the United States is determined to hold Russia accountable for its war of aggression against Ukraine.”said Thomas-Greenfield.

“Setting up a damage register to document claims from Russia’s brutal war is a crucial step in this effort. Together with the Council of Europe, we support Ukraine.”added the diplomat.

In November 2022, the UN General Assembly passed a resolution recommending the creation of an international register of damages caused by Russia’s “internationally wrongful acts” in Ukraine.

By setting such a record, the Council of Europe is taking an important step in holding Russia accountable for its war of aggression, according to the US mission to the UN.

The US government plans to provide funding and work with Congress to support the initiative.

This will be one of the most important decisions that will emerge from the summit of the Council of Europe, the organization from which the Russian Federation was suspended on February 25, 2022 and excluded on March 16 of the same year.

A national diplomatic source told the Lusa agency that the completion of this register of damages caused by Russia in the war against Ukraine is considered “a first step towards the subsequent establishment of a compensation mechanism”.

In addition to this agreement between the member countries of the organization, the summit that will take place from Tuesday to Wednesday in Reykjavik, Iceland, should also issue a political statement that aims to form a document “of union around the values ​​and principles” . of the Council of Europe, according to the same source.

The Council of Europe was established in 1949 to promote human rights, democracy and the rule of law. Headquartered in Strasbourg, France, it includes 46 Member States, 27 of which are members of the European Union. The United States participates as an observer state.
